Block

#21,609,797
Block Number
21,609,797 @ 05/07/2025, 14:12:10
Status
Finalized
ID
0x0149bd45bbe4de8ee63a3e71e1ff04523881487b108498f308e85ff40ca7be7f
Transactions
Gas Used
2397832/40000000 (5.99% Used)
Total Score
2,110,387,227 (+99)
Rewards
9.16 VTHO